Situated in the centre of Rome, 1.3 km from The Vatican and 400 metres from Piazza Navona, Quiet Retreat in Ancient Rome offers free WiFi and air conditioning. The property is700 metres from Pantheon, 1.3 km from St Peters Square and 1.3 km from Palazzo Venezia. Synagogue of Rome is 1.3 km away and Via Condotti is 1.2 km from the apartment.
The spacious apartment has 1 bedroom, a flat-screen TV and a fully equipped kitchen that provides guests with a dishwasher, an oven, a washing machine, a microwave and a fridge. Towels and bed linen are available in the apartment. For added privacy, the accommodation features a private entrance.
Popular points of interest near the apartment include Castel SantAngelo, Campo de Fiori and Largo di Torre Argentina. Rome Ciampino Airport is 18 km from the property.
